How Ōnin Staffing earned full-plant workforce responsibility at a major automotive manufacturer by showing up, learning the operation, and performing.
A major automotive manufacturing plant — one of the largest assembly operations in the region — depends on a consistent, high-volume workforce across multiple departments running simultaneous shifts. When its primary staffing vendor began to lose pace with growing demands, plant leadership needed a replacement it could trust with its full headcount, but it was not handing that trust over without seeing performance first.
The plant’s longtime staffing partner could not keep pace with growing demand. Ōnin was brought to prove we had what it took to deliver.
Ōnin’s first assignment was the Friday-Saturday shift: paper time sheets, no time clock, 60 people needed with unpredictable show rates and uncompetitive pay.
Other vendors had lost accounts across the market by trying to dictate terms. The plant wanted a partner that would listen and execute, not try to lower the stakes.
Ōnin leadership showed up every Friday until the Ōnin Onsite program was fully established.
Proven performance in the weekend shifts led to engine support, which then grew to managing the full plant.
Transitioned operations from paper time sheets to a digital time system and deployed a full embedded Onsite team.
Cultivated a relationship so robust that the plant’s COO communicates with Ōnin directly, six years in.
